Armed robbers threaten Conisbrough shop staff

GUNMEN threatened store staff in Conisbrough before being forced to leave empty handed.

The attempted armed robbery took place at a newsagent’s on Micklebring Grove at around 5.40pm last Wednesday (April 23) when two men dressed in dark clothing with their faces covered entered the shop.

They are alleged to have threatened a woman, who was the only member of staff in the store, with a handgun and demanded cash.

The woman raised the alarm and the two men fled the store empty handed. Once outside, the two men are believed to have ran up Micklebring Grove and on to Maple Grove where they joined a third man also dressed in dark clothing.

All three men are then reported to have turned right on to Sycamore Grove and then got into a burgundy Citroen Saxo that was parked on the street and driven off towards Chestnut Grove.

Anyone who may have witnessed the incident or has any information is urged to contact the police on 101, or Crimestoppers anonymously on 0800 555111, quoting incident number 800 of 24 April 2014
